Consumer behavior is constantly shifting, driven by a myriad set of factors. To thrivingly navigate this dynamic landscape, businesses must regularly analyze trends and decipher the motivations behind consumer actions. This requires a deep immersion into demographics, lifestyle, economic conditions, and social influences. By uncovering these patterns, companies can adapt their services to meet evolving consumer needs.
This exploration often relies on a blend of qualitative and quantitative research.
Surveys, focus groups, and customer reviews provide valuable insights check here into consumer attitudes. Meanwhile, sales data, website analytics, and industry publications offer a quantitative perspective on consumer actions.
By combining these diverse data sources, businesses can obtain a holistic understanding of consumer trends. This knowledge is essential for formulating effective marketing strategies, optimizing product development, and ultimately driving business profitability.

Exploring Sentiment Through Textual Analysis
Textual analysis plays a essential role in sentiment mining. By analyzing the textual content, we can uncover the underlying emotions, opinions, and attitudes expressed within it. This process involves a range of techniques, including natural language processing (NLP), machine learning, and deep learning algorithms. These tools enable us to detect keywords, phrases, and patterns that indicate the sentiment expressed in a text. The outcomes of textual analysis can be invaluable for businesses, researchers, and individuals seeking to understand public opinion, assess customer satisfaction, or monitor social media trends.
